Guidance for Selection and Integration
When evaluating whether this clipart set fits your project, consider the overall tone you wish to achieve. It excels in projects aiming for a romantic, rustic, vintage, or garden-inspired aesthetic. For a minimalist or ultra-modern brand, the elements might work better as occasional accents rather than foundational pieces. Before committing, test how the elements interact with your existing design assets, particularly your chosen fonts. The soft, organic shapes of the clipart often pair beautifully with elegant serif fonts for a classic feel, or with clean sans-serif fonts for a more contemporary contrast. A flowing script font can complement the hand-painted quality, but ensure it remains legible when used for body text.
Always review the technical specifications to ensure they meet your project’s needs. The 3000 px, 300 DPI PNG elements are high-resolution, making them suitable for both digital use and print design without loss of quality. The seamless patterns at 12x12 inches are tile-ready, a huge time-saver for creating large-scale backgrounds for packaging design or printed materials.
